Tranny Cooler Lines
 
I've got an aftermarket valve body in my transmission that up'ed the line pressure...And one of the quick disconnects blew on me.

Temp. have dishwasher hose and a barb piecing it back together to get it home.:argh:

Does anyone make a good set of aftermarket lines or even the quick disconnects? I'm thrashing factory lines.

I got rid of my factory lines as well. I work at a Deere dealership, and I had them make up 1/2" hoses with 1/2" (-8) JIC fittings on them. That's what I am running now. Needed to make some pipe to JIC fittings to adapt what comes out of the transmission, but that wasn't too bad at all. I didn't spend $100 on the entire setup. I cut the hose to the cooler and installed a barbed/JIC fitting and hose clamps.

Well this brings my attention to the above.What is the line pressure at idle and at WOT?Both of my trucks have aftermarket TBs ect with stock lines. I Know that the idle line pressure is 98 PSI and the WOT pressure is 150 PSI. Maybe I should change to some GOOD S.S. Nonburst lines.:humm:

My quick connects started leaking as well, and that's the main reason I tossed them. The hose I am using is rated for 600PSI, and has a cotton braid in it, not metal wire. Makes them very easy to work with.
